python pyasn1.egg
时间: 2023-12-28 08:02:05 浏览: 37
Python pyasn1.egg 是一个 Python 库,用于处理 ASN.1(Abstract Syntax Notation One)格式的数据。ASN.1 是一种数据序列化标准,用于在计算机网络通信和数据交换中进行数据编码和解码。
pyasn1.egg 库为 Python 用户提供了一系列用于处理 ASN.1 数据的工具和功能,包括编码、解码、解析和验证 ASN.1 数据结构的能力。使用该库,开发者可以轻松地处理和操作各种 ASN.1 格式的数据,而无需手动编写复杂的编码和解码逻辑。
这个库的使用非常灵活,可以轻松地与现有的 Python 应用程序集成,并且提供了丰富的文档和示例,便于开发者学习和使用。在网络通信、安全协议和数据交换等领域,pyasn1.egg 可以帮助开发者高效地处理和管理 ASN.1 数据,提高开发效率和数据处理能力。
总之,Python pyasn1.egg 是一个强大的 Python 库,为处理 ASN.1 数据提供了便捷的解决方案,使开发者能够更加轻松地操作和管理 ASN.1 数据,同时也为 Python 生态系统的完善和发展做出了重要贡献。
相关问题
PS C:\Users\Administrator\Desktop\PythonSDK> python C:\Users\Administrator\Desktop\PythonSDK\PythonSDK\Python_SDK\setup.py install running install E:\anaconda\lib\site-packages\setuptools\command\install.py:34: SetuptoolsDeprecationWarning: setup.py install is deprecated. Use build and pip and other standards-based tools. warnings.warn( E:\anaconda\lib\site-packages\setuptools\command\easy_install.py:144: EasyInstallDeprecationWarning: easy_install command is deprecated. Use build and pip and other standards-based too ls. warnings.warn( running bdist_egg running egg_info creating ecloud_python_sdk.egg-info writing ecloud_python_sdk.egg-info\PKG-INFO writing dependency_links to ecloud_python_sdk.egg-info\dependency_links.txt writing requirements to ecloud_python_sdk.egg-info\requires.txt writing top-level names to ecloud_python_sdk.egg-info\top_level.txt writing manifest file 'ecloud_python_sdk.egg-info\SOURCES.txt' error: package directory 'ecloud' does not exist
根据你提供的信息,安装过程中出现了错误。错误提示显示缺少名为'ecloud'的包,导致无法安装成功。
这个问题可能是由于安装文件或目录结构不正确导致的。你需要确保安装文件包含所有必要的源文件,并且目录结构正确。
你可以尝试重新下载安装文件,或者检查安装文件的目录结构是否正确。如果问题仍然存在,你可以尝试手动创建名为'ecloud'的目录,并将源文件放入其中,然后重新运行安装程序。
希望这些信息能够帮助你解决问题!
command "python setup.py egg_i
### 回答1:
nstall" 是用来做什么的?
这个命令是用来安装 Python 包的。在执行这个命令之前,需要先下载并解压缩 Python 包,然后进入包的根目录,执行命令即可安装该包。这个命令会将包安装到 Python 的 site-packages 目录下,以便在 Python 中使用该包。
### 回答2:
指令 "python setup.py egg_i" 是用于在Python项目中创建和构建egg文件的命令。Egg文件是一种用于分发和安装Python软件包的文件格式。通过这个命令,我们可以将项目的源代码、依赖库和其他必要文件打包成一个egg文件,方便分享和安装。
这个命令的具体作用有以下几点:
1. 它会在当前目录执行setup.py文件,setup.py是一个用于配置Python安装和分发的脚本文件。
2. 使用egg_info选项,该命令会生成一个dist文件夹,并在该文件夹中创建一个包含项目元信息的egg-info目录。
3. egg-info 目录中包含了项目的名称、版本、作者、依赖关系等元信息,这些信息可以帮助正确地安装和使用项目。
4. Egg文件还可以包含项目的源代码、资源文件和其他必要的文件,以便于分发和安装。
5. 构建完成后,可以使用egg文件将项目部署到其他机器上,只需简单地将egg文件复制到目标机器,然后使用pip等工具进行安装即可。
总结来说,"python setup.py egg_i" 是一个用于创建和构建Python项目的egg文件的命令,通过将项目的源代码和必要文件打包成egg文件,方便项目的分享和安装。
### 回答3:
command "python setup.py egg_info" 是一个用于 Python 的命令行指令。这个命令是 setuptools 包的一部分,通常在安装第三方 Python 包时使用。
"egg_info" 是一个 setuptools 的功能,用于创建一个包含项目元数据的 ".egg-info" 目录。在这个目录下,包括了一些关于包名、作者、版本、依赖等信息的文件。这些元数据文件可以用来描述和管理项目的元信息。
通过在命令行中运行 "python setup.py egg_info",可以生成这个 ".egg-info" 目录。一些常见的用法是在安装第三方包之前先运行这个命令,这样可以确保项目的元数据被正确创建和保存。同时,这个命令也常用于开发环境中,当需要更新或修改项目的元数据时。
总结而言,command "python setup.py egg_info" 是用于在 Python 项目中创建 ".egg-info" 目录并管理项目的元数据的命令。